PHP与JS实现烈火战神抽奖系统教程

【标题】PHP和JS仿烈火战神抽奖是一个基于PHP和JavaScript技术实现的抽奖应用实例,帮助开发者理解如何结合这两种语言来创建互动性强的网页应用。该项目利用PHP作为服务器端语言处理逻辑,JavaScript则在客户端进行用户界面的交互和动画效果的实现。

【描述】该项目是一个学习和实践过程,开发者通过模仿热门游戏烈火战神的抽奖环节,构建了一个简易版的抽奖功能。这个例子适合初学者,帮助他们理解PHPjQuery在实际项目中的运用,以及如何实现前后端的通信。

以下是这个项目涉及的关键技术点:

  1. PHP基础:包括变量声明、条件语句(如if...else)、数组操作等,用于实现随机数生成和奖品判断逻辑。
  2. 数据库操作:通过mysql.php,可能涉及到MySQL数据库的连接、查询、插入和更新操作,使用PDO或mysqli扩展进行数据操作。
  3. AJAX:JavaScript通过AJAX与服务器进行异步通信,获取抽奖结果,避免页面刷新,提升用户体验。
  4. jQuery库:简化DOM操作,提供动画效果,如平滑过渡、淡入淡出等,使得抽奖过程更具吸引力。
  5. HTML/CSShuodong.html定义抽奖界面的结构,CSS用于美化界面,完成抽奖盘布局。
  6. 数据库设计test.sql包含抽奖系统的数据库脚本,存储奖品表、用户表等数据。
  7. 前后端交互:JavaScript通过HTTP请求与PHP进行通信,更新前端界面。
  8. 安全考虑:防止重复抽奖和作弊等问题,需对请求进行验证。
  9. 响应式设计:考虑适配不同设备的屏幕尺寸,确保移动端和桌面端均能良好展示。

通过这个项目,开发者可以学习完整的Web应用开发流程,从后端处理到前端展示,提升全栈开发能力,同时巩固和应用PHP和JavaScript的知识。

zip 文件大小:1.63MB